Frequently Asked Questions
How can I keep my back cool while carrying a laptop in hot weather?
Choose a backpack with a ventilated or channelled back panel, lightweight fabric and adjustable hip/sternum straps to move weight off your shoulders. If you frequently walk long distances in heat, opt for a convertible roller (like the BAGSMART) or use a luggage strap to attach the pack to wheeled luggage. Also pack sweat-prone items in a wet pocket or separate compartment to avoid direct contact with the laptop sleeve.
Will my laptop overheat if I carry it in a backpack during summer?
Laptops can run warmer if stored next to hot clothing or in a tightly sealed bag. To reduce risk, keep your laptop in a separate padded sleeve away from sweaty clothes or wet pockets, use breathable organizers, and avoid leaving the bag in direct sun. Water-resistant fabrics help protect against moisture, but ventilation and separation are the primary protections against heat transfer.
